Output 996786823593185c72803b81c612613b58bbec0eb1cb9e321f5f23719c11e0e7:75

value
681896
script pubkey
OP_0 OP_PUSHBYTES_20 bfee209365015503ae31266197f2a09951e6bdfe
address
bc1qhlhzpym9q92s8t33yese0u4qn9g7d00729ktee
transaction
996786823593185c72803b81c612613b58bbec0eb1cb9e321f5f23719c11e0e7
spent
true